文章滚动效果的实现_第1页
文章滚动效果的实现_第2页
文章滚动效果的实现_第3页
文章滚动效果的实现_第4页
文章滚动效果的实现_第5页
已阅读5页,还剩22页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

文章滚动效果的实现20XX汇报人:XX目录01滚动效果的定义02实现滚动效果的技术03滚动效果的设计原则04滚动效果的优化方法05滚动效果的测试与调试06滚动效果的案例分析滚动效果的定义PART01滚动效果的含义滚动效果通过连续的视觉移动,模拟真实世界中物体的滚动,增强用户体验。视觉连续性滚动效果使得用户与内容的交互更加直观,通过滑动来浏览信息,提高操作的便捷性。交互性增强滚动效果的类型单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。滚动效果的应用场景在网页设计中,滚动效果常用于长页面内容的展示,使用户可以方便地浏览更多信息。网页内容展示电子书阅读器通过滚动效果模拟翻页,为用户提供接近纸质书的阅读体验。电子书阅读许多移动应用使用滚动效果来展示新闻、图片或菜单选项,提升用户体验。移动应用界面010203实现滚动效果的技术PART02CSS技术实现通过设置CSS的overflow属性为auto或scroll,可以实现内容溢出时的滚动效果。01使用overflow属性利用@keyframes定义滚动动画,结合animation属性,可以创建平滑的滚动动画效果。02CSS关键帧动画使用transform属性的translateY或translateX函数,可以实现元素在垂直或水平方向上的滚动。03transform属性JavaScript技术实现通过JavaScript的DOM操作,可以动态地改变元素的位置,实现滚动效果。使用DOM操作结合JavaScript和CSS3动画,可以创建流畅且复杂的滚动动画效果。利用CSS动画使用JavaScript监听滚动事件,根据滚动位置动态调整页面元素,实现响应式滚动效果。监听滚动事件其他编程语言实现通过JavaScript可以控制DOM元素的滚动行为,实现平滑滚动效果,增强用户体验。使用JavaScriptjQuery插件如ScrollMagic可以简化滚动动画的实现,通过简单的配置即可完成复杂的滚动效果。结合jQuery插件CSS3提供了动画和过渡效果,可以实现元素滚动的视觉效果,无需额外的JavaScript代码。利用CSS3动画滚动效果的设计原则PART03用户体验设计简洁性原则01设计滚动效果时,应避免过度装饰,保持界面的简洁,以提升用户的阅读体验。一致性原则02确保文章滚动效果在不同页面或部分之间保持一致,减少用户的学习成本和操作困惑。反馈及时性03滚动时应提供即时反馈,如滚动条或动画效果,让用户清楚自己的操作状态和位置。视觉效果设计选择合适的色彩搭配,确保文字与背景对比度高,以提升阅读体验和视觉吸引力。色彩搭配原则0102合理运用淡入淡出、滑动等动画过渡效果,使文章滚动更加流畅自然,避免突兀感。动画过渡效果03精心挑选易读性强的字体,并注意排版的整洁与一致性,以增强文章的专业性和可读性。字体选择与排版功能性设计在实现滚动效果时,应优化性能,避免卡顿或延迟,以提供流畅的用户体验。滚动效果应考虑到不同用户的需求,包括残障人士,确保所有用户都能无障碍地访问内容。设计滚动效果时,应确保用户能够轻松控制内容的滚动,如通过触摸或鼠标滚轮。用户交互体验内容的可访问性性能优化滚动效果的优化方法PART04性能优化通过使用文档片段或虚拟DOM技术减少直接DOM操作,提高页面滚动性能。减少DOM操作使用响应式图片和懒加载技术,减少初始加载时间,提升滚动时的流畅度。优化图片资源利用代码分割和按需加载,减少初次加载的资源量,优化滚动时的资源加载效率。代码分割与按需加载兼容性优化利用CSS3的transform和transition属性实现平滑滚动,同时确保在不支持的浏览器中提供回退方案。使用CSS3特性01通过polyfills或shims为旧版浏览器提供必要的JavaScript功能支持,确保滚动效果在各浏览器中表现一致。JavaScript兼容性处理02使用媒体查询针对不同屏幕尺寸和分辨率进行滚动效果优化,保证在各种设备上均有良好的用户体验。媒体查询适配03用户交互优化通过使用媒体查询和弹性布局,确保文章滚动效果在不同设备上均能提供良好的用户体验。响应式设计合理应用CSS3的动画缓动函数,使滚动动作更加平滑自然,提升用户交互的舒适度。动画缓动效果为触摸操作添加即时反馈,如滚动条颜色变化或震动提示,增强用户的操作感知。触摸反馈利用懒加载或预加载技术,优化图片和内容的加载速度,减少用户等待时间,提升滚动流畅性。预加载优化滚动效果的测试与调试PART05测试方法单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击此处添加文本具体内容调试技巧利用浏览器的开发者工具进行实时滚动效果调试,快速定位问题元素和代码。使用开发者工具使用设备模拟器测试不同屏幕尺寸和分辨率下的滚动效果,确保兼容性。模拟不同设备通过性能分析工具检测滚动效果的帧率和渲染时间,优化动画流畅度。性能分析定期进行代码审查,检查滚动效果实现的代码质量,避免潜在的bug。代码审查常见问题解决针对滚动效果卡顿问题,优化代码逻辑和资源加载,确保流畅体验。性能优化确保滚动效果在不同浏览器和设备上均能正常工作,避免兼容性问题。兼容性测试调整滚动触发的交互反馈,如滚动条样式或位置,提升用户体验。交互反馈调整添加异常捕获和处理机制,确保在出现错误时能够给出明确提示并恢复滚动效果。异常处理机制滚动效果的案例分析PART06成功案例展示单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。案例效果分析单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内容,简明扼要地阐述您的观点。单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。案例经验总结单击添加文本具体内容,简明扼要地阐述您的观点。根据需要可酌情增减文字,以便观者准确地理解您传达的思想。单击添加文本具体内

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论